The Regional Directorate of Education (DRE) has announced the opening of a common recruitment procedure for the hiring of a Higher Technician in diagnostic and therapeutic areas (TSDT), specializing in Speech Therapy. The position will be filled under an indefinite public service employment contract.
The selected professional will join the multidisciplinary team supporting inclusive education, being responsible for activities related to the prevention, assessment, and treatment of human communication disorders in educational establishments in the Autonomous Region of Madeira.
Applications must be submitted using the form available on the Regional Directorate of Education portal (www.madeira.gov.pt/dre/), sent via email to [email protected] or by registered mail with acknowledgment of receipt.
